Abstract

A study on the crude extracts of Erechtites valerianifolia extracted first by hexane followed by chloroform and finally by ethanol was carried out. Thin layer chromatography (TLC) analysis of the crude extracts reveals the presence of a visible bright yellow spot which may indicate the presence of flavanoid compounds. Flavanoid detection from a previous study confirms this. The hexane extract was subjected to column chromatography and six fractions with similar occurrence of spots on TLC were obtained. Infrared spectroscopy was carried out on all the crudc extracts and fractions revealing the presence of similar transmission patterns which corresponds to the assignments of carbonyl, hydroxyl, CH and C=C which further supports the presence of flavanoid compounds. Cytotoxicity test on the crude extracts reveal that only the ethanol extracts yields cytotoxicity.
